Frequently Asked Questions
Personalized 1-on-1 instruction lets a tutor focus on your specific weak areas—whether that's understanding political systems, analyzing maps, or interpreting primary sources. Rather than moving at a class pace, your tutor can slow down on concepts you find challenging and accelerate through material you already know. This targeted approach helps you build confidence and improve your score more efficiently than general test prep classes.
Your first session typically involves an assessment to understand your current knowledge, identify gaps, and learn about your learning style. The tutor will review your goals, discuss which topics feel most challenging, and create a personalized plan. You'll likely start working through practice questions or key concepts so the tutor can see exactly where to focus your efforts.
Improvement depends on your starting point and how frequently you meet with a tutor, but many students see noticeable progress within 4-8 weeks of consistent tutoring. If you're working on specific weak areas—like document analysis or historical timelines—focused sessions can help you master those skills quickly. Regular practice between sessions and active engagement with the material accelerates your progress.
